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.

Dacia Duster is clearly cheaper – starting at 16,300 £ , while the McLaren Super Series Roadster costs 274,300 £ . That’s a price difference of around 258,008 £.

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Dacia Duster uses 4.7 L/100km and is clearly more efficient than the McLaren Super Series Roadster with 12.2 L/100km. The difference is about 7.5 L/100km.

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the McLaren Super Series Roadster offers clearly more power – delivering 750 HP compared to 158 HP. That’s roughly 592 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the McLaren Super Series Roadster is substantially quicker – completing the sprint in 2.8 s, while the Dacia Duster takes 9.4 s. That’s about 6.6 s quicker.

There’s also a difference in torque: the McLaren Super Series Roadster delivers substantially more torque with 800 Nm compared to 230 Nm. That’s about 570 Nm more.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Seats: Dacia Duster offers more seats – 5 vs 2.

In terms of curb weight, Dacia Duster is barely lighter – 1,377 kg compared to 1,438 kg. The difference is around 61 kg.

Looking at boot space, the Dacia Duster offers considerably more boot space – 517 L compared to 58 L. That’s a difference of about 459 L.
